Overview
Prepare for a thriving career in Business Intelligence (BI) by mastering essential skills such as SQL, Excel, and data management. This comprehensive program is designed to get you job-ready in less than 4 months, irrespective of your prior experience.
As a Business Intelligence analyst, you will transform raw data into meaningful insights that facilitate strategic decision-making within an organization.
You'll also create market intelligence and financial reports. This program equips you with knowledge in data collection, analysis, visualization, and reporting, refining your skills to develop data models and derive invaluable insights for informed decision-making.
You'll analyze data from various data sources, such as relational databases and data warehouses.
In addition, you will be trained to use the latest tools in the field, including Tableau, IBM Cognos, Google Looker, and Excel. You’ll apply statistical analysis methods to visualize data, create interactive dashboards, and present data compellingly.
Upon completing the program, you’ll have a portfolio of projects and a Professional Certificate from IBM, showcasing your expertise.
You'll also gain access to resources to aid in your BI Analyst job search, including resume development and interview preparation.
Begin your journey towards a rewarding career in business intelligence and lay a solid foundation for future roles in data analytics, data science, data engineering, supply chain, or healthcare with this program.
